I started fusing glass in 2019.  My son and daughter inspired me to do something with the glass I had held onto since my college days. I started fusing glass in a microwave kiln in my kitchen. Then a mishap with a hot pad, catching on fire and leaving a burn mark on my kitchen floor it was requested I moved my working space into my garage.

After I was moved to my garage my husband scored me a kiln from the 70’s from a couple on craigslist. It is not a large kiln but it gave me the space and ability to try different pieces.

I have found so many ways to challenge myself while trying to obtain patience.  I am inspired by seeing how glass can change by not only color, but shape and form once fused.

I have learned that there are so many different things one can create with glass, the different types of glass(non fusible glass can’t actually be fused), that can be used, different ways to fuse the glass, different molds, techniques, and firing schedules.
